当前位置: 懒人建站 > JS代码 > 网页特效 >

只半透明背景不透明文字的CSS写法

通常直接写filter:alpha(opacity=50) 会把文字一起透明,该CSS写法可以实现只半透明背景不透明文字。提示兼容IE6/IE7/火狐。
相关代码
分享到:

代码说明:

通常直接写filter:alpha(opacity=50) 会把文字一起透明,该CSS写法可以实现只半透明背景不透明文字。提示兼容IE6/' target='_blank'>兼容IE6/IE7/火狐。代码简洁。了了几行:
 #container{ border:1px solid #c00; background-color:rgba(212,0,0,0.5);
*background:#f00; *filter:alpha(opacity=50); width:500px; margin:40px auto; line-height:200%; font-size:14px; padding:14px;}
 #container *{ position:relative;}

CSS解释:
IE不支持background-color的rgba,而IE只有在透明容器的子节点(文本节点除外)内设置position:relative才能不继承其父记得透明滤镜,只有火狐等浏览器支持rgba。 

来源:懒人建站|发布人:懒人建站|2010-02-26|热度:|收 藏|报 错


相关代码

懒人建站

登 录| 注 册